WebIn 2024 wages for Registered Nurses ranged from $57,980 to $105,550 with $79,920 being the median annual salary. Broken down to an hourly rate, workers in this field made anywhere from $27.88 to $50.75. The median hourly rate was $38.42. In 2024 the median pay for this field was $38.22 an hour. The hourly rate grew by $0.20. Web5 jan. 2024 · Learn to tend to patients' basic needs and support senior nurses by training to become a Certified Nurse Assistant (CNA). Commonly referred to as Nursing Aides, CNAs typically work in nursing homes and assisted living facilities. In Connecticut, such allied health professionals make $36,100 mean annual wage, according to the Bureau of Labor.
